Fremont, Neb. – (Feb. 28, 2025) Fremont Public Schools is pleased to announce that Jessica Sorensen will be joining the administrative team as the Assistant Director of Special Education and Principal of the Pathfinder Program. Sorensen will replace Heather Beekman who resigned to take a position at Wahoo Public Schools.

Sorensen has a Bachelor’s degree in elementary and special education from Peru State College and a Master’s degree from Morningside College. Sorensen has been with the district for 10 years, serving as a teacher in the Pathfinder Program.

"We are excited that Jess will be the new Assistant Director of Special Education/Pathfinder Principal. With her unwavering dedication, deep understanding of our students' needs, and a proven track record of excellence in the classroom, we are confident that she will continue to be an asset in providing the best opportunities for our students," said Joel Kerkman, director of special education.

Sorensen will begin her new role on July 1, 2025.
